An essential element of Termite Control Weston's strategy is developing a long lasting chemical shield. This is achieved by injecting a liquid termiticide into the soil surrounding the building's whole external edge. In lots of communities where homes rest on concrete pieces, the product is pumped into the ground to close any spaces in the protected zone. Contemporary treatment techniques often count on non‑repellent chemicals, which are especially powerful because foraging termites can not sense the substance as they move through the dealt with earth. Rather than being warded off, they carry the active ingredient back to their main nest and distribute it throughout the colony, ultimately damaging the nest entirely. This method uses a far stronger and longer‑lasting solution compared to older repellent barriers.
For properties where the ground is covered by extensive paving or where owners choose a different method baiting and tracking systems offer a highly reliable option. These systems involve putting discreet stations at tactical intervals around the yard to act as an early warning system. These stations include lumber inserts that attract termites before they reach the primary structure of your home. Once activity is validated a customized development regulator bait is added to the station. The employees consume the bait and disperse it throughout the colony which prevents the insects from molting and eventually triggers the whole population to collapse. This proactive Termite Control Weston approach is typically favored for its ecological precision and its ability to intercept new colonies migrating from nearby bushland or reserves throughout Australia.
Property owners also play a vital function in the success of these expert systems by handling ecological elements that can draw in pests to their property. Termites are mainly drawn to moisture and accessible wood sources. Making sure that garden beds are not developed versus the walls of the house and that cooling units recede from the structures are easy however essential actions. It is also essential to prevent storing cardboard boxes or lumber offcuts in subfloor locations or directly on the ground near the house. When these upkeep practices are combined with expert Termite Control Weston the threat of a significant invasion is drastically reduced. Routine inspections remain the last piece of the puzzle enabling any breaches in the defense to be captured before they result in costly repair work.
